Features and Benefits
- Guaranteed 1/2 LSB INL (max)
- Low Supply Current
- 325µA (Normal Operation)
- 0.4µA (Full Power-Down Mode)
- Single-Supply Operation
- 3V (MAX5234)
- 5V (MAX5235)
- Space-Saving 10-Pin µMAX Package
- Output Buffers Swing Rail-to-Rail
- Power-On Reset Clears Registers and DACs to Zero
- Programmable Shutdown Modes with 1kΩ or 200kΩ Internal Loads
- Resets to Zero
- 13.5MHz SPI/QSPI/MICROWIRE-Compatible, 3-Wire Serial Interface
- Buffered Output Drives 5kΩ || 100pF
Product Details
The MAX5234/MAX5235 precision, dual-output, 12-bit digital-to-analog converters (DACs) consume only 360µA from a single 5V (MAX5235) or 325µA from a single 3V (MAX5234) supply. These devices feature output buffers that swing rail-to-rail. The internal gain amplifiers maximize the dynamic range of the DAC output.
The MAX5234/MAX5235 feature a 13.5MHz 3-wire serial interface compatible with SPI, QSPI, and MICROWIRE. Each DAC input is organized as an input register followed by a DAC register. A 16-bit shift register loads data into the input registers. Input registers update the DAC registers independently or simultaneously. In addition, programmable control bits allow power-down with 1kΩ or 200kΩ internal loads.
The MAX5234/MAX5235 are fully specified over the extended industrial temperature range (-40°C to +85°C) and are available in space-saving 10-pin µMAX packages.
